Dr. Melody Blanco – Associate Professor

Educational Background
PhD(s) in Nursing Education, Indiana University of Pennsylvania
Doctor of Nursing Practice, University of North Florida
Master of Science in Nursing, Herzing University
Bachelors Degree in Nursing, ECPI University
Bachelors Degree in Psychology, University of Maryland Global Campus
Professional Experience
Dr. Melody Blanco is a doctorally-prepared advanced practice nurse with over 10 years of cumulative experience in nursing education, clinical practice, and research. She is deeply committed to patient-centered care, innovative pedagogical approaches, and evidence-based practice.
Research Interests
Dr. Blanco’s research experience includes studying the relationships between antipsychotics and metabolic syndrome, concept-based teaching, the use of simulation in education, and the exploration of affective learning in nursing education.
